How Do Santa Ana Winds Elevate Coastal Home Susceptability?



Santa Ana winds enhance home susceptability by driving completely dry, pressurized air toward the coastline and transferring stired up particles throughout substantial distances. These severe gusts push melting cinders right into small voids in roofing, soffits, and wall surface assemblies. Common building styles often include revealed eaves or susceptible house siding materials that ignite when embers gather. Setting the exterior shell acts as the primary line of protection versus these wind-driven wildfire hazards.

Which Roof Covering Products Offer the Best Defense Versus Ashes?



Class A fire-rated roofing products supply the supreme defense versus ash intrusion and straight fire get in touch with. High-grade floor tile, slate, standing-seam steel, and concrete roofing settings up stop heat transfer properly. Homeowner should make certain service providers seal all roof side voids with non-combustible bird stops or metal blinking. Eliminating open spaces under roofing ceramic tiles avoids wind-driven coal from going into the underlying roof framework.



How Does Home Siding Selection Protect Against Thermal Heat Transfer?



Non-combustible outside siding produces a durable barrier that mirrors high radiant heat and stands up to direct flames. Products such as thick traditional stucco, concrete panels, and high-density fiber concrete do not stir up when subjected to extreme radiant heat. Setting up an underlying fireproof sheath beneath the main house siding adds a vital second protection layer. This multi-layered exterior wall surface approach keeps interior architectural framework safe during intense heat exposure.

Why Are Enclosed Soffits and Ember-Resistant Vents Vital?



Encased soffits stop hot air currents and shedding ashes from obtaining caught below exterior roofing system overhangs. Specialty vents featuring great mesh testing block ashes while preserving needed attic ventilation. These corrosion-resistant metal displays quit bits as little as one-sixteenth of an inch from entering inner attic room areas. Upgrading exterior air flow points safeguards hidden roof rooms from interior ignition.



What Window and Door Features Resist Extreme Warmth Exposure?



Dual-pane windows outfitted with toughened up exterior glass resist fracturing under serious heat stress and anxiety far better than conventional annealed glass. Multi-pane home window assemblies maintain convected heat from firing up interior window therapies or furniture. Sturdy fire-rated outside doors featuring durable weather removing block draft pathways that could draw coal into living locations. Selecting enhanced metal or fiberglass door structures guarantees architectural integrity throughout thermal occasions.

Exactly How Should Homeowner Framework Home Ignition Areas?



Homeowners need to keep a zero-ignition area extending 5 feet of the structure utilizing crushed rock, concrete pavers, or rock attractive rock. The prompt five-foot perimeter must continue to be totally devoid of flammable mulch, wood fencing, or dense vegetation. The secondary protection area, prolonging thirty feet from the home, calls for low-growing plants, well-irrigated lawn, and widely spaced trees. Removing dead raw material continually maintains gas levels minimal throughout both zones.



Which Native Plant Kingdoms Support Fire Resistance and Coastal Elegance?



Fire-retardant plants feature high wetness material, low sap quantity, and very little leaf shedding throughout seasonal environment changes. Variety such as agave, delicious ranges, California lilac, and deep-rooted groundcovers absorb heat without sparking swiftly. Avoiding resinous plants like eucalyptus, yearn, and ornamental grasses prevents rapid flame spread out near living areas. Integrating hardscape preserving walls and rock pathways creates all-natural firebreaks across outdoor spaces.

What Is the Most Vulnerable Part of a Coastal Home Throughout a Wildfire?



Roofing assemblies and open exterior vents stand for the single most at risk entry factor for flying embers. Burning coal take a trip miles ahead of energetic flames, touchdown on roof covering surfaces or obtaining sucked right into attic vents. Setting roof sides and installing ember-proof testing removes these usual ignition paths.



Can Existing Homes Be Retrofitted for Fire Resistance Without Full Demolition?



Existing frameworks can undertake effective fire-resistance retrofitting with targeted outside upgrades. Replacing wood house siding with fiber concrete, upgrading to dual-pane toughened up windows, and confining open eaves significantly improves security. These concentrated modifications dramatically reduced structural risk without needing full teardown construction.
